Transaction 5c85aeecb5525c96289e5f264cedf45f9a07ce37834d606a93c045244008ec59

3 Input
1 Outputs
  • 5c85aeecb5525c96289e5f264cedf45f9a07ce37834d606a93c045244008ec59:0
  • value  343969
    address  1N1MwBzVp92rdPoXvVXr9Z2YHZireu4sFC